Escape modern Osaka and venture into this narrow cobbled alley lined with traditional wood-fronted restaurants and a temple famed for its deity covered in moss.

What can I see and do near Hozen-ji Temple?
You'll want to browse the collections at Osaka Museum of History, Osaka Science Museum and Osaka Museum of Housing and Living. Explore notable local landmarks like Shitennoji Temple, Osaka Central Public Hall and Osaka Tenmangu Shrine. You can watch performances at Osaka Shochikuza, Namba Grand Kagetsu Theater and National Bunraku Theater if you're interested in local theatre.
How can I get to Hozen-ji Temple?
With so many ways to get around, seeing all of the area near Hozen-ji Temple is simple. Head over to Namba Station (Nankai) for metro transport. If you're taking a train to the area, Osaka-Namba Station is the closest station to Namba.
